
WinCC的三个主要项目区别在于应用场景、功能模块和授权方式。WinCC作为西门子推出的工业自动化监控系统,分为WinCC Basic、WinCC Comfort和WinCC Advanced三个版本,分别对应不同规模的工业需求。WinCC Basic适用于小型设备、功能精简;WinCC Comfort支持中级HMI开发、具备更多可视化工具;WinCC Advanced面向复杂系统、支持分布式架构和高级脚本功能。
以WinCC Advanced为例,其核心优势在于支持多用户协作和冗余系统设计。它允许工程师在大型工厂中部署分布式服务器,实现数据同步和故障切换,同时提供VBS和C脚本接口,满足定制化逻辑需求。相比之下,Basic版本仅支持单机运行和基础报警功能,而Comfort版本虽然增加了配方管理和面板扩展,但无法实现跨站点的数据整合。
一、WINCC BASIC:小型自动化解决方案的起点
WinCC Basic是TIA Portal(全集成自动化平台)中的入门级HMI/SCADA组件,专为简单的机器级监控设计。其最大特点是集成度高、成本低,适合OEM设备制造商或小型产线。例如,在包装机械或传送带控制中,Basic版本可通过精简的图形库快速构建操作界面,但缺乏复杂的数据归档和第三方通信协议支持。
从授权角度来看,WinCC Basic通常与西门子Basic系列PLC(如S7-1200)捆绑销售,无需单独购买授权。然而,它的局限性也很明显:仅支持最多3个过程变量归档、无法连接SQL数据库,且HMI画面数量受限。若用户后期需要扩展功能(如远程访问或高级报警管理),则必须升级至更高版本。
二、WINCC COMFORT:平衡性能与成本的中端选择
WinCC Comfort定位于中型自动化项目,在Basic的基础上增加了配方管理、趋势曲线和面板移植等关键功能。例如,在食品加工行业,Comfort版本可通过配方功能存储不同产品的工艺参数(如温度、时间),并一键调用以切换生产模式。此外,其支持的ProDiag工具能实现设备状态的智能诊断,减少停机时间。
与Basic相比,Comfort版本的授权独立于硬件,可灵活搭配多种PLC使用。它支持最多64个远程连接(通过WinCC Runtime Advanced),并允许用户自定义VB脚本。但需注意,其分布式架构能力仍有限——单个项目最多支持4台服务器,且无法实现跨地域的数据同步。对于需要全球工厂数据汇总的企业,仍需选择Advanced版本。
三、WINCC ADVANCED:复杂工业系统的核心平台
WinCC Advanced是西门子面向大型基础设施(如汽车厂、化工厂)的旗舰级监控系统。其核心差异在于支持服务器-客户端架构、冗余系统和开放式接口。例如,在汽车焊接车间,Advanced版本可通过多台服务器并行处理数万个I/O点,并通过OPC UA或Web API与MES/ERP系统集成。其内置的Audit TrAIl功能还能满足FDA/GMP等合规性审计需求。
在技术细节上,Advanced版本突破了前两者的硬件限制:单项目可管理超过1000台设备,归档数据可存储于Microsoft SQL Server,并支持通过HTML5实现跨平台访问。此外,其选件(如WinCC/WebNavigator)允许全球工程师通过浏览器实时监控产线。但相应的,其授权成本显著提高,且需要专业的IT团队维护服务器集群。
四、版本选择指南:匹配需求与长期规划
选择WinCC版本时需评估项目规模、扩展性和预算三条准则。对于单机设备(如数控机床),Basic版本足以满足基础监控;若涉及多生产线协同(如电子装配),Comfort的配方和诊断功能更具性价比;而跨国企业建设数字孪生工厂时,Advanced的分布式架构和IT集成能力不可替代。
长期来看,西门子的版本升级路径较为清晰:从Basic到Comfort可通过授权升级实现,但迁移至Advanced可能需要重构项目架构。因此,建议在规划初期预留20%~30%的性能冗余,避免因产线扩建导致的系统重构风险。例如,某光伏板制造商最初选择Comfort版本,但在三年后因新增海外工厂被迫更换Advanced,导致额外投入150%的改造成本。
五、技术生态与未来演进
WinCC的差异化不仅体现在软件功能上,还反映在生态系统兼容性中。Advanced版本全面支持工业4.0标准,如通过SIMATIC IT与MindSphere云平台对接,实现预测性维护。而Basic/Comfort版本仅能通过间接网关(如OPC Server)实现有限的数据上云。
西门子已明确将AI和边缘计算作为WinCC未来的发展方向。在V7.5版本中,Advanced用户已可调用Python脚本训练设备异常检测模型。这种技术代差意味着,选择低版本可能导致企业无法接入下一代智能工厂体系。对于追求技术前瞻性的用户,即使当前需求简单,也应评估Advanced版本的长期价值。
相关问答FAQs:
1. WinCC的三个项目分别适用于哪些行业或应用场景?**
WinCC的三个项目通常包括WinCC Basic、WinCC Professional和WinCC Runtime Advanced。WinCC Basic适合小型自动化项目,通常用于简单的监控和控制系统,广泛应用于制造业的基础设备。WinCC Professional则针对中大型系统,提供更强大的数据处理和分析能力,适用于复杂的生产过程和企业管理。WinCC Runtime Advanced则专注于高性能的运行时环境,适合需要高可用性和可靠性的应用,如石油、化工等行业。
2. 选择哪个WinCC项目最符合我的需求?**
选择适合的WinCC项目取决于项目的规模、复杂性和预算。如果项目较小,且仅需基本的监控功能,WinCC Basic是一个合适的选择。对于需要更复杂数据处理与分析的中型项目,WinCC Professional将更加合适。而如果你的项目要求高性能和高可用性,例如在关键工艺控制中,WinCC Runtime Advanced将是最佳选择。
3. WinCC项目之间的技术差异有哪些?**
WinCC项目之间的技术差异主要体现在功能、扩展性和性能上。WinCC Basic功能相对简单,适合少量的设备连接和基本的数据显示。WinCC Professional则支持更多的设备连接和高级功能,如趋势分析、报警管理和多用户访问。WinCC Runtime Advanced在性能和可靠性上有显著提升,支持复杂的分布式架构和高负载的实时数据处理,适合大规模的工业环境。








